Inheriting Amano Shuzo, which had continued since the Edo period, in 2010, Morita Kinshachi Shuzo remains steadfast to the tradition of manual labor by craftsmen in all processes, from rice washing to pressing, in the brewing town of Kamezaki, Handa City.
Their flagship brand, bearing the name of Aichi's symbol "Golden Shachihoko," uses local Aichi rice and clear water to pursue a refined flavor where the rich inherent umami of rice and a transparent, smooth mouthfeel coexist.
Its solid quality, backed by numerous awards at competitions, and the deep body brewed with traditional equipment continue to fascinate sake lovers domestically and internationally across generations.
